Medical Science Liaison
We are seeking Medical Science Liaisons who will help build relationships and demonstrates the clinical outcome and benefits of Client products. Provides medical information and coordinates educational workshops, round tables, medical forums, etc.. May explore and identify sites for clinical trials in all stages of development. Incumbents have a deep scientific and clinical education and experience.
Within Field Medical Affairs, this position functions as a scientific liaison between our Client and key external customers to further scientific exchange. The MSL provides advanced product and scientific and medical field support to Medical, Sales and Marketing, as well as Managed Care and Government by using academic/professional credentials and scientific expertise to communicate with health care providers, organized providers/accounts and other relevant healthcare organizations. Strategic determination of change of territory prioritization will be based on customer need and analytics which identify need for change. This may occur at any time throughout the annual performance cycle. Develops and maintains medical (territory and account) plans in coordination with the MSL Field Director.
The successful candidate will be highly motivated with clinical or scientific knowledge in Neurology, specifically Alzheimers Disease, have good analytical decision-making abilities, and exceptional business acumen.
Serves as organization spokesperson on advanced medical and technical projects with the ML teams, Clinicians, Marketing, Market Access & Government, and Sales personnel. External relationships include key opinion leaders (KOLs), academic institutions, physicians, nurse practitioners, Alzheimers Disease educators, pharmacists, blood bank staff, organized providers/IDNs, and MCOs as needed based on territory archetypes.
